Fight Cabin Fever: Indoor Activities for Kids
Family Movie Night Ideas
This is an inexpensive activity that is always a hit for the whole family — especially if you pick a movie that you already have. You could even set up a pillow fort and make it feel like a sleepover. For a little extra fun, pop some popcorn kernels and have everyone choose their own topping!
Find the Best Board Games for Kids
For a screen-free activity, a board game night is a great option. Choosing a game that the kiddos will enjoy might take some effort, but that just means more opportunities for fun and variety!
Baking and Cooking
This activity has double the benefits: not only do you get to kill some time by mixing and baking your favorite treat, but you also get to enjoy the benefits of eating the treats after! While your treats are baking and you already have a mess in the kitchen, why not whip up a meal together? Try making something new and get everyone involved.
Read a Book Together
Even if you have young kids, you don’t have to read a picture-book together. Pick up something fun like Harry Potter or Charlotte’s web and play-round robin, giving everyone a chance to read a paragraph or two — bonus points for giving each character their own voice!
Play Charades
This game is a great way to let the kids expend some energy while letting the adults soak it up.
At Home Science Experiment
Thanks to the internet, you can now find many different experiments to do at home with ingredients you already have on hand like slime.
Write Letters
Now that we have the technology to communicate instantly, things like handwritten letters have gone by the wayside. Revitalize handwritten letters with some construction paper and crayons.
Watercolor Art Projects
Break out the paints and paper and let your creativity flow. This may sound like a fun indoor activity for kids only, but there’s no reason adults can’t pick up some paints, too!
Make a Blanket Fort
This is another activity that sounds like it’s kids-only, but now is the time to let your inner-child out! Use every blanket in the house and see how big you can make the fort. Then grab some pillows to sit on and eat your lunch inside the fort while admiring your handiwork.
